SYRACUSE, N.Y. – The Syracuse women's volleyball team hosts Virginia Tech on Friday, Oct. 27 at 7 p.m., and Virginia on Sunday, Oct. 29 at 1 p.m. in the Women's Building. The Orange (15-8, 7-3 ACC) is coming off a three-set victory at Clemson on Oct. 22.Â

Ebangwese on the Block
Santita Ebangwese is among the national leaders in total blocks. Entering the weekend, Ebangwese's 116 blocks rank 15th nationally and first in the ACC.     Â

The Hokies
Virginia Tech (8-13, 2-8 ACC) holds a 7-2 all-time series advantage over Syracuse. The Hokies won in four sets one season ago. The last 'Cuse victory came in 2015. Â Â Â Â Â Â Â Â Â Â
Â
Belle Sand has accumulated 52 digs against VT in four career matches. Kendra Lukacs produced 10 kills with 12 digs in last year's meeting. Â
Â
Ester Talamazzi and Jaila Tolbet lead Virginia Tech with 249 and 218 kills, respectively. Rhegan Mitchell has a team-high 793 assists and Carol Raffety has a team-leading 310 digs.
Â
The Cavaliers
The Orange is 6-3 all-time against Virginia (4-17, 0-10 ACC) and is in search of its fifth straight win in the series. 'Cuse took last year's meeting in four sets and has not been defeated by the Cavaliers since 1992.Â
Â
Anastasiya Gorelina led the way with 16 kills and 11 digs. Ebangwese and Lukacs combined for 14 kills with six blocks and Jalissa Trotter added 28 assists. Sand has 49 digs in three matches against Virginia.
Jelena Novakovic leads the Cavaliers with 217 kills on the year. Megan Wilson has a team-high 540 assists, Kelsey Miller leads the team with 251 digs and Chino Anukwuem has a team-leading 53 blocks.Â
Coach's Thoughts
"We need to be consistent this weekend," said head coach Leonid Yelin. "To keep the dream alive, we need to win these two matches at home and prepare to face four good schools on the road."
